Connectivity and Features: Versatility for Modern Audio Needs
Pyle speakers come equipped with a variety of connectivity options, ensuring that users can easily integrate them into their existing audio setups. Many models support Bluetooth connectivity, allowing for wireless streaming from smartphones, tablets, and other devices. This feature is especially valuable for those who want to connect their speakers to various sources without the hassle of tangled wires. In addition to Bluetooth, some models offer traditional connections like AUX, RCA, and optical inputs, making them versatile and adaptable for a range of devices.
Additionally, Pyle speakers include several features that enhance the user experience. Some models come with built-in amplifiers, eliminating the need for separate components and making setup much easier. Remote control functionality is also common, allowing users to adjust volume, switch tracks, or change settings from a distance. For those interested in customizing their sound experience, certain models also feature adjustable equalizers, giving users more control over bass, treble, and midrange frequencies. This versatility and array of features make Pyle speakers highly adaptable to different audio needs.

Potential Drawbacks: What to Keep in Mind Before Buying
While Pyle speakers offer many benefits, there are a few considerations to keep in mind before purchasing. For starters, the sound quality, while impressive for the price, may not satisfy audiophiles or those with a very discerning ear. The bass, in particular, may lack the depth and punch found in more expensive systems. Additionally, some users have noted that the build quality, while solid, can feel less premium compared to higher-end speakers, especially in terms of the materials used for certain models.
Another factor to consider is that Pyle’s customer service may not be as responsive or comprehensive as some premium brands. Although this is not necessarily a dealbreaker, it could be a consideration if you encounter issues with your product. For users who are looking for high-end sound systems or specialized features, Pyle may not meet all expectations. Nonetheless, for those who prioritize affordability and reliability, these potential drawbacks are relatively minor.
